class SDPointingHandler
{
public:
// default ctor is not attached to a MS and hence is useless until attached
SDPointingHandler();
// attach this to a MS, mark fields row which are handled here
SDPointingHandler(MeasurementSet &ms, Vector<Bool> &handledCols, const Record &row);
// copy ctor
SDPointingHandler(const SDPointingHandler &other);
~SDPointingHandler() {clearAll();}
// assignment operator, uses copy semantics
SDPointingHandler &operator=(const SDPointingHandler &other);
// attach to a MS, mark fields in row which are handled here
void attach(MeasurementSet &ms, Vector<Bool> &handledCols, const Record &row);
// reset internals given indicated row, use the same MS
void resetRow(const Record &);
// fill - a new row is added when
// a) the name changes
// b) the time changes such that it would be outside of the new interval when
// added to the old interval (i.e. intervals do not overlap)
// c) the direction changes
// d) the antennaId changes
// There is no look-back to see if a previous row could be re-used
void fill(const Record &row, Int antennaId, Double time, const Vector<Double> &timeRange,
const MDirection &direction, const MeasFrame &frame);
// convenience functions for use when filling the FIELD table, which is mostly
// just a clone of this table for SD data
Int nrow() {return rownr_p+1;}
const String &name() {return name_p;}
Int directionRefType() {return dirColRef_p.getType();}
const Matrix<Double> &directionPoly() {return directionPoly_p;}
Double time() {return time_p;}
private:
MSPointing *msPointing_p;
MSPointingColumns *msPointingCols_p;
Double time_p;
Int antId_p;
MDirection direction_p;
Matrix<Double> directionPoly_p;
Vector<Double> directionRate_p;
String name_p;
Int rownr_p;
MDirection::Ref dirColRef_p;
RORecordFieldPtr<String> objectField_p;
// these might come from an MS table
// this can just come from an MS v1 table
RORecordFieldPtr<Array<Double> > pointingDirRateField_p;
RORecordFieldPtr<Double> intervalField_p, timeField_p;
RORecordFieldPtr<String> nameField_p;
RORecordFieldPtr<Bool> trackingField_p;
// cleanup everything
void clearAll();
// cleanup things which depend on the row
void clearRow();
// initialize everything
void initAll(MeasurementSet &ms, Vector<Bool> &handledCols, const Record &row);
// initialize everythign which depends on row
void initRow(Vector<Bool> &handledCols, const Record &row);
};
